Small Yellow Croaker Cooked with Beef Tripe Exclusive
Tiny yellow croakers simmer into silky beancurd sheets, the tofu ribbons soaking up milky, ocean-sweet broth while the fish stays delicate. A soupy, comforting dish where the tofu often outshines the fish.
Instructions
- 1
Ingredients: small yellow croaker (cleaned), thick tofu skin, ginger slices, scallions.
- 2
Place the thick tripe on the cutting board and cut it open.
- 3
Then, put the cut thick tripe into a pot of boiling water and blanch for 1 to 2 minutes before taking it out.
- 4
Heat oil in a pan, then add the small yellow croaker and pan-fry both sides briefly.
- 5
Then, add ginger slices and an appropriate amount of cooking wine.
- 6
Add an appropriate amount of boiling water.
- 7
Add an appropriate amount of soy sauce.
- 8
Add an appropriate amount of salt.
- 9
Add an appropriate amount of zero-calorie sugar.
- 10
Season and cook for 5 to 6 minutes.
- 11
Then, add the blanched thick tripe and stir-fry for 1 to 2 minutes.
- 12
Finally, add the scallions and it’s done.
